#a17546 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a17546 is composed of 63.1% red, 45.9%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 56.5%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 31 degrees, a saturation of 39.4% and a lightness of 45.3%. #a17546 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ffea8c with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#a17546 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a17546 has RGB values of R:161, G:117,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.57,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10581318.

Shades and Tints of #a17546
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0805 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a17546
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757472 is the less saturated color, while #df7708 is the most saturated one.
